Transportation from City Center to Khartoum International Airport
Known as the capital and largest city of Sudan, Khartoum is located on the banks of the Nile River. Khartoum International Airport, the largest airport in the country, welcomes domestic and foreign visitors and serves many international airline companies.
The distance between the city center and Khartoum International Airport is approximately 40 kilometers. Transportation options such as taxi, car rental and hotel shuttle are used to get to the airport from the city center.
Some hotels in Khartoum provide transfer services to their customers between the city center and the airport. You can choose this option for transportation by getting information about the transfer service from the hotel where you will stay.
If you are planning to come to the airport from the city center, be sure to negotiate the fare before you set off. Thus, you can complete your airport journey both quickly and in a more affordable way.
Those who plan to rent a car and have an independent and comfortable journey during their trip to Khartoum can contact the car rental companies at the airport.

Transportation from Domodedovo Airport to the City Center
Train, bus, taxi, car rental and private transfer options can be used to reach the city center from Domodedovo Airport.
Express buses have more frequent services on the airport city center line, where Express and Ryazan buses serve. The fastest and most economical means of transportation to the city center is the train. From the train station in the airport terminal, it takes 40-50 minutes to get on high-speed trains, and 60-75 minutes to reach the city center by standard trains.
It is possible to use taxis from the taxi stand located in the passenger exit section of the airport terminal. It is recommended to ask the price before using the taxi, which takes 20-40 minutes depending on the traffic density and the distance to be traveled.
It is also possible to reach the city center and the airport by using the rent a car offices at the airport terminal and the transfer vehicle service. The city center and the airport are 22 km away.
Transportation from Sheremetyevo Airport to the City Center
Sheremetyevo Airport is 29 km from Moscow city center. Bus, train, taxi, car rental services can be preferred on the route from Sheremetyevo Airport to the city center.
Municipal buses, which serve on three different routes, depart from the airport terminal. Buses 817 and 948 run to Planernaya district, buses 949 and 851 to Rechnoy Vokzal district, bus line H1 runs on the route of Leninskiy Prospect.
You can get service on the desired route from the taxi stands located at the exit gates of the airport arriving passenger terminal. Before getting in the taxi, it is useful to get confirmation about the destination and the fare.
There is a connection between the Aeroexpress trains and the city center airport. The journey takes about 30 minutes by trains running between Belorussky Train Station and Sheremetyevo Airport.
Transportation from Vnukovo Airport to the City Center
It is possible to use train, bus, minibus, car rental service and taxi options to reach the city center from Vnukovo Airport.
You can reach the city center by taking a taxi from the taxi stands located at the exit gates of terminals A and B of the airport's arrivals terminal, which is 28 km away from Moscow city center. Before getting into the taxi, it is necessary to tell the route to go and get price information.
You can also use city buses to connect Vnukovo Airport to the city center. From the bus stops in the parking lot, it takes 30-45 minutes to reach Moscow city center depending on the traffic density and the route. Minibuses supporting the buses depart from Terminal A. You can reach the city center in 20-30 minutes by minibuses, which offer a faster alternative than the bus.
There are direct trains from the airport to Kievskiy Train Station in the city center of Moscow. The 45-minute journey is both economical and comfortable. Aeroexpress is written on the trains.
